Every event type must have a registered schema before producers can emit it; the registry rejects unregistered payloads at the broker. Schema changes go through compatibility checks — backward-compatible additions are automatic, breaking changes need a steward sign-off. If the registry's admin console becomes unreachable, maintainers can fall back to the offline recovery shell on the ops bastion. Access to that shell requires the passphrase recorded directly below this paragraph.

unlock words, kagef-taduf: fenir-quenix-norwyn-sorvan-gormir-gorir-fraok

Leadership Review — Support Outsourcing, quick brief for department heads. We're proposing to move tier-one customer support for the Pellaro app to Northgale Services, keeping tier-two in-house at the Averly office. Expected savings: roughly 18% annually, with a six-month transition. Staff impact plans are still being worked through with HR. The confidential commercial detail sits just below.

confidential, bahap-bajog: Zorethix Works is in early talks to buy Kelethox Foods for about $30.7 million. The Ralvan launch date is September 19, and nothing goes to the press before then.

**Ticket: Cron drift — connection failures**

Jobs on the Tickwright scheduler are drifting up to four minutes. Suspect the heartbeat writes are timing out and retrying, which pushes subsequent runs. Plugin authors: do not add your own retry wrappers; it compounds the drift. Reproduce by running the drift probe against the shared diagnostics database using the connection string below.

primary connection of tawif-yajeg = postgresql://rusiel_svc:G879q9cx6GsSvj@db-dd9f.norvagrid.internal:5432/casath

Ticket: Zero-downtime migration stalled on Pellworth's orders table. The expand phase completed, but the backfill job in Stonebridge paused at 64% and the dual-write shim is still active, so old and new columns are diverging slowly. Do not run the contract phase. Restart the backfill worker with the reduced batch size, confirm lag drops, then ping the Harrowgate data team before proceeding. All related logs in the migration dashboard carry the trace token shown below.

build token for tawip-yageg: htk9_92ac43d42